Saugerties has gone 9-1 against New Paltz recently and they'll look to pad the win column further on Wednesday. The Sawyers will welcome the Huguenots at 11:00 a.m. Saugerties is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 7 runs per game this season.
The home team had won the previous three meetings between Saugerties and Roosevelt, and Saugerties kept the tradition alive. The Sawyers came out on top against the Presidents by a score of 6-3 on Monday.
Jess Gumbel was excellent, scoring two runs and stealing a base while getting on base in all three of her plate appearances. She also hit a double, marking her first of the season. Stefanie Cogswell was another key player, scoring a run and stealing a base while getting on base in three of her four plate appearances.
Meanwhile, after soaring to 17 runs the game before, New Paltz was a bit more limited in their game on Tuesday. They fell just short of Marlboro Central by a score of 4-2. The loss was the Huguenots' first of the season.
New Paltz sa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Lili Tozzi, who went 1-for-2 with one home run and two RBI.
The victory got Saugerties back to even at 2-2. As for New Paltz, their loss was their first of the season and makes their record 3-1.
Wednesday's contest will be a test for both teams' pitchers. Saugerties hasn't had any issues making contact this season, having earned a batting average of .322. However, it's not like New Paltz struggles in that department as they've averaged .386. With both teams so capable at the plate, fans should be ready for an impressive hitting performance.
Saugerties came out on top in a nail-biter against New Paltz in their previous matchup back in May of 2024, sneaking past 5-4. Will the Sawyers repeat their success, or do the Huguenots have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
